1. Healthy Malaysian Peanut Salad Dressing Recipes:

  • Prep Time: 5 Minutes
  • Cooking Time: 5 minutes
  • Serves: 4
  • Ingredients: 
  1. 2 tsp of Orient Asian Malaysian Curry Paste
  2. ¼ cup peanut paste
  3. 2 tbsp honey
  4. 1 tbsp soy sauce
  5. 2 tbsp apple cider vinegar
  6. 2-4 tablespoons of warm water (to thin the salad dressing)
  • Method: 
  1. Add all ingredients to a bowl or a mason jar and blend until it is all mixed together. In the event that you are utilizing a mason jar, you can just put the top on and shake the container until it is mixed well.
  2. You can drizzle it on your salads or use it as dips for chicken skewers- the possibilities are endless. 

2. Healthy Curry Tahini Dressing: 

Heavenly, creamy healthy and delicious curry tahini dressing with cosy flavours. This compelling dressing will be your new most loved approach to utilising tahini! It’s exquisitely savoury with a lot of umami flavour because of the tahini and earthy turmeric.

  • Prep Time: 5 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 5 minutes
  • Serves: 4
  • Ingredients: 
  1. 1 ½ tsp Orient Asian Indonesian Curry Paste
  2. ¼ cup tahini
  3. 1 clove of garlic, finely diced
  4. 1 or 2 tbsp maple syrup
  5. ½ tbsp grated ginger
  6. ½ tsp salt 
  7. Freshly ground black pepper
  • Method: 
  1. Add all ingredients to a bowl or a mason jar and blend until it is all mixed together. In the event that you are utilizing a mason jar, you can just put the top on and shake the container until it is mixed well.
  2. This salad dressing is great in thai inspired salads, or drizzled over burgers, meatballs or even as a dip for veggies and sweet potato fries. 
  3. This dressing also tastes great with broccoli chickpea salad. It is a delicious way for vegetarians to get proteins. 

3. Healthy Lemon Basil Vinaigrette Salad Dressing Recipes:

Homemade healthy lemon basil vinaigrette that is ideal for spring! This light, crisp dressing makes the ideal marinade or delightful dressing. The tartness of the lemon juice and dijon mustard make an enchanting combo with the sweetness of the honey. The best part? You will mostly have all of the ingredients in your kitchen as of now!

  • Prep Time: 5 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 5 minutes
  • Serves: 4
  • Ingredients: 
  1. 2 tsp OrientAsian Thai Green Curry Paste
  2. ¼ cup freshly squeezed lemon juice
  3. ¼ cup olive oil
  4. 1 clove of garlic diced
  5. ½ tsp dijon mustard
  6. ½ tsp honey
  7. Freshly ground salt and black pepper, to taste
  • Method: 
  1. Add all ingredients to a bowl or a mason jar and blend until it is all mixed together. In the event that you are utilizing a mason jar, you can just put the top on and shake the container until it is mixed well.
  2. This delicious dressing will quickly become your go-to for a quick and easy salad and also it makes for a delicious marinade. 

4. Avocado Lime: 

Creamy, cool, and invigorating, this avocado lime dressing works extraordinary on servings of salads or served as a delectable dip for fresh veggies. Avocado is an incredible source of heart-healthy monounsaturated fats and may help support your HDL (good) cholesterol levels.

  • Prep Time: 5 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 5 minutes
  • Serves: 4
  • Ingredients: 
  1. 3 tsp Orient Asian Green Thai Curry Paste
  2. 1 avocado, diced into small chunks
  3. ½ cup plain greek yoghurt
  4. ¼ cup lime juice
  5. 4 tbsp olive oil
  6. 2 cloves of garlic, diced
  7. Salt and pepper to taste
  • Method: 
  1. Add the chunks of avocado to a food processor alongside the Greek yoghurt, Orient Asian Thai Green Curry Paste, lime juice, olive oil, and minced garlic. 
  2. Top with a touch of salt and pepper and afterwards beat until the mixture has a smooth, thick consistency.

5. Greek Yoghurt Ranch Salad Dressing Recipes: 

Versatile, creamy, and flavorful, ranch dressing is one of the most famous dressings for salads available. In this custom made homemade alternative, Greek yoghurt gives a healthy twist to this delicious dressing. This variant functions admirably as a dipping sauce or dressing.

  • Prep Time: 5 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 5 minutes
  • Serves: 4
  • Ingredients: 
  1. 1 tsp of Orient Asian Sri Lankan Curry Paste
  2. 1 cup of plain greek yoghurt
  3. ½ tsp dried dill
  4. Dash of cayenne pepper
  5. Pinch of salt to taste
  6. Fresh chives, diced (optional)
  • Method: 
  1. In a bowl or mason jar, mix the greek yoghurt, Orient Asian Sri Lankan Curry Paste and dried dill. 
  2. Add a pinch of cayenne pepper and salt. 
  3. Garnish the dressing with fresh chives before serving over salads or as a dip. 

6. Chilli Almond Dressing: 

This dressing is the perfect example of how dressings don’t need to be loaded with oil or sugar to taste good. This dressing can be sweetened with dates and uses creamy almond butter as a base for a ridiculously easy and equally delicious salad dressing. This dressing is oil free, vegan, low in carbs and gluten free. 

  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 5 minutes
  • Makes about 1 cup
  • Ingredients:
  1. 1 tsp Orient Asian Red Chilli Paste
  2. ½ cup natural almond butter (sugar free)
  3. 2 tbsp freshly squeezed lemon juice
  4. 1 tbsp low sodium tamari or soy sauce
  5. 1 inch of french ginger, peeled
  6. 1 or 2 cloves of garlic
  7. 1 pitted date
  8. ⅓ cup of water
  • Method: 
  1. Mix all ingredients including Red Chilli paste together in a high speed blender. If there are leftovers they can be stored in a sealed container in the refrigerator. The dressing will thicken as it sits so don’t hesitate to include a little water if necessary.

8. Ginger Turmeric Dressing: 

This ginger turmeric dressing can help add a pop of colour to your plate. It has a lively flavour that can supplement bean salads, mixed greens, or veggie bowls. It additionally includes both ginger and turmeric, two fixings that have been related to a few medical advantages. For instance, ginger may help lessen nausea, mitigate muscle agony, and abatement your glucose levels. In the meantime, turmeric contains curcumin, a compound very much researched for its anti-inflammatory and antioxidant properties. 

  • Prep Time: 5 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 5 minutes
  • Serves: 4
  • Ingredients: 
  1. 1 tsp of Orient Asian Indonesian Curry Paste
  2. 1/4 cup (60 ml) olive oil
  3. 2 tablespoons (30 ml) apple cider vinegar
  4. ½ tsp ginger grated
  5. 1 tsp honey
  • Method: 
  1. In a bowl, mix all the ingredients including Indonesian curry paste together. 
  2. To improve the flavour, you can opt to add a bit of honey for sweetness.
